PUTRAJAYA: The Federal Court has reserved its judgement in the appeal by the National Registration Department (NRD) to determine whether a Muslim child conceived out of wedlock can use their father's name instead of "bin Abdullah".
Chief Justice Tun Md Raus Sharif who chaired a five-man panel of judges, said they would deliver a decision on a date to be fixed.
